Sharpirhynchia acutiplicata Brown 1849

Rhynchonellata - Rhynchonellida - Rhynchonellidae

Alternative combinations: Kallirhynchia acutiplicata, Terebratula acutiplicata

Belongs to Sharpirhynchia according to X. Shi and R. E. Grant 1993

See also Brown 1849 and Buckman 1917

Sister taxon: Sharpirhynchia sharpi

Type specimen: Its type locality is Cheltenham, Upper Trigonia Grit, which is in a Bajocian carbonate grainstone/packstone in the Salperton Limestone Formation of the United Kingdom

Distribution:

• Jurassic of France (1 collection), the United Kingdom (5)

Total: 6 collections each including a single occurrence
